The easiest pets, ranked.

Which pets are genuinely low-effort - and which only look it? Rather than invent scores, we ranked all 585 species we cover by what our own profiles actually say: every guide was scanned for ease language ("hardy", "beginner-friendly", "low-maintenance") and warning language ("demanding", "for experienced keepers"), written long before this page existed. The method is fully disclosed below. One honest caveat up front: "easy" for a fish and "easy" for a dog are different currencies - compare within a category first.

πŸ“ Methodology, in full

Each of our 585 species guides was scanned at build time (this page recomputes whenever a guide changes). We count matches of ease phrases - beginner-friendly, good for beginners, first-time owner/keeper, easy to care/keep, low-maintenance, forgiving, hardy, undemanding, easy-going, ideal/perfect/great first - and warning phrases - not for beginners, not for first-timers, experienced owners/keepers, advanced, demanding, challenging, specialist, high-maintenance, difficult, expert. Score = ease minus warnings. Video production notes in the source files are excluded.

Limits, honestly: this measures how our own writers talk about a species, not a lab measurement; a long guide has more chances to score than a short one; and "easy" is relative to its category - the easiest dog still needs daily walks no fish will ask for.
